Why did he wait until now?

You see it every year. They often hold off on possible minor surgeries in hope that rest and rehab will fix the problem. If they start working out and the issue flares up again, time for the surgery. If it's major, they'll obviously do it sooner. Pretty common, but sometimes the worst is realized - see Merriman last year. He held off on surgery all together and it didn't work out very well.
